#d3140d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d3140d is composed of 82.7% red, 7.8% green and 5.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 90.5% magenta, 93.8% yellow and 17.3% black. It has a hue angle of 2.1 degrees, a saturation of 88.4% and a lightness of 43.9%. #d3140d color hex could be obtained by blending #ff281a with #a70000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0000.

#d3140d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d3140d has RGB values of R:211, G:20, B:13 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.91, Y:0.94, K:0.17. Its decimal value is 13833229.

Shades and Tints of #d3140d
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080100 is the darkest color, while #fef5f4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d3140d
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#746c6c is the less saturated color, while #dc0c04 is the most saturated one.
